Yes  it does... Together with that I was using version 3.2.1 of BrOffice
(which is outdated because until that version, BrOffice was mainly
maintained by OpenOffice principal code)... Now I switched to version
3.3.1 (maintained by LibreOffice) and the problem was solved (now the
layout of my PPTX and DOCX files is kept exactly the same, also the
program don't crash suddenly anymore)... Thanks for your help :) ... You
made me think twice what I was choosing to use as software...

>   Problem: I can't save a file at DOCX or PPTX and keeping the layout I
>   gave to it... Generally, the highlight of a phrase or word that I've
>   put vanishes (this happens at DOCX files)... I can't save the arrows
>   (they show glitches too if I initiate the Presentation Mode and pass
>   through them fastly - Pressing Enter when the animation of the arrows
>   are still running) that I put inside the PPTX files... Together with
>   that, the OpenOffice crashes when I open a large PPTX files (When this
>   file has a lot of Slides or has a lot of animations, images and
>   etc)...
> 
>   What I want to do: Save at PPTX or DOCX without losing any data or
>   layout (Again, I contacted the OpenOffice team and they told me this
>   is a (K)Ubuntu problem - They say the OpenOffice don't have native
>   support to DOCX or PPTX files)...
